Accelerating Climate-Friendly Waterway Investments
In the project “Vauhtia ilmastomyönteisiin vesistöinvestointeihin (VIIVI)”, we aim to improve water well-being in Kanta-Häme, prevent nutrient runoff, adapt to climate change, and safeguard biodiversity.

Accelerating Growth Through Plant-Based Food Innovations (Kasvis-TKI)
The project aims to expand the variety of plant-based products by providing comprehensive information and recipes throughout the entire supply chain, while forming new collaborative networks.

Biogas and Valuable Components from Industrial Waters (Vesitar)
We promote the circular economy by exploring opportunities to utilize valuable components and organic matter derived from industrial by-products and wastewater, for example, in the production of biogas and microalgae.

CAgriLab – Consolidated virtual living lab platform for knowledge sharing and adaption in regenerative agriculture
We are establishing a consolidated virtual living lab platform in an international project to enhance knowledge exchange in agriculture. This will support collaboration and data sharing, helping farmers adopt and adapt regenerative practices to improve soil health and promote sustainable agriculture.

Carbon-wise Biogas and Nutrients for Circulation in Kanta-Häme (BioKanta)
The goal of the BioKanta project is to promote the successful implementation of biogas investments in the Kanta-Häme region. The project involves examining biogas solutions based on various scales and feedstocks, providing guidance for those considering facility investments, and generating research data on farm-scale processing solutions to promote nutrient and carbon cycling.

Cutting Food Loss and Waste in Europe (CIBUS)
CIBUS aims to reduce food loss and waste by increasing regions’ capacity to develop innovative regional policies. Local and regional authorities have an important role in creating a policy environment that stimulates prevention and reduction of food loss and waste.

Digi4CSA – Digital Solutions to Foster Climate-smart Agricultural Transition
In the Digi4CSA project, funded by the Research Council of Finland, the goal is to build a digital solution for assessing and monitoring the environmental and economic impacts of climate-smart agriculture (CSA). The solution aids stakeholders in decision-making and tracking the results of CSA.

Digital CityCarbon 2.0 Kanta-Häme
In the Digital Urban Carbon 2.0 dual project, we explore what new and complementary data, as well as methodological recommendations, can be produced to support cities’ low-carbon efforts, specifically regarding the carbon sinks in built natural environments.

Domestic Bio-raw Materials in Health and Wellness Products (FarKos)
We develop and study methods for processing domestic side streams, as well as for the production and processing of bio-based raw materials such as cultivated plants, fungi, and algae. These raw materials are researched and utilized in the development of cosmetic and pharmaceutical products.

Durable biopigments and binders (Biopigments)
In Durable biopigments and binders (Biopigments) project, we promote the transition of the dyes and binders industry from fossil raw materials to renewable raw materials.
